Bread and Butter Bakery is a cute bakery in the town square in Covington. It is sooooo cute with immaculate vibes inside. We tried numerous drinks, macarons (oreo, red velvet, and pumpkin), and oreo cake. We thoroughly loved all of it, it was so fresh and we have to say the red velvet and pumpkin macarons were so delicious.

Overall, they have great food options and decent coffee. The set up is a little strange with food and drinks being ordered at different sides of the store. Service has not been stellar likely due to the fact that employees have had to run to both ordering sites after taking my order for a pastry and coffee. Perhaps they were short-staffed the times I've been in, so I'm looking forward to giving them another try soon. 🙂
